A Troubling Pattern: Multiple Disappearances

Alaysha Jackson, a 13-year-old girl from Steelton, Pennsylvania, has been reported missing multiple times over the past few years, raising concerns about her safety and well-being. Her most recent disappearance occurred on the evening of Monday, May 19, 2025, when she was last seen around 10:30 p.m. at her home on Chambers Street in Swatara Township, Dauphin County. Local authorities, including the Swatara Township Police Department and Dauphin County Juvenile Probation, initiated a search for her, urging the public to report any information regarding her whereabouts. 

This incident is not the first time Alaysha has been reported missing. In March 2025, when she was 12 years old, she was last seen leaving her residence in the 300 block of Chambers Street in Steelton on a Saturday evening. An update later confirmed that she had been found. 

Earlier, in February 2024, at the age of 11, Alaysha was reported missing after leaving her home in the Enhaut-Steelton area around 6:30 a.m. She was last seen wearing a black hooded sweatshirt with a white Nike logo on the front, black pants, and black Crocs, and was carrying two tote bags, one black and one purple. 

In March 2022, at the age of 9, Alaysha was reported as a runaway. She was last seen in the 300 block of Chambers Street in Steelton, wearing a black jacket with fur around the hood, a pink undershirt, dark pants, and white shoes. Her hair was in braids.
